JPMorgan Chase & Co., formed by the 2000 merger of J.P. Morgan & Co. and Chase Manhattan Bank, is a global financial services giant headquartered in New York City, tracing its roots back to 1799 through its predecessor firms. As one of the largest banks in the world, it operates across investment banking, commercial banking, asset management, and consumer ban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ers, corporations, and governments. Led by CEO Jamie Dimon since 2005, the firm is renowned for its role in high-profile deals, robust trading operations, and its Chase retail banking network, which includes extensive credit card and mortgage services. Combining a legacy of financial innovation with a dominant market presence, JPMorgan Chase remains a cornerstone of the global economy.

JP Morgan Chase's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, JP Morgan Chase held 7,888 positions worth $1.53T, up 12% from $1.37T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 25% of the portfolio.

JP Morgan Chase's Q2 2025 filing shows 634 new, 2,517 increased, 3,216 reduced and 856 closed positions. Its largest new stake was JPMorgan Mortgage-Backed Securities ETF: 10,818,420 shares worth $543M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$4.6B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
